Property Description

Historical Charm and Period Features
The Prince Rupert Hotel, once home to Prince Rupert, offers a unique blend of historical charm and period features. From timber-framed architecture to original tapestries and suits of armour, immerse yourself in the rich history of Shrewsbury.

Culinary Delights
Indulge in a culinary journey at the hotel's two restaurants. The Royalist Restaurant showcases creative dishes with seasonal produce amidst a backdrop of exquisite tapestries. For a more casual dining experience, Chambers Brasserie offers a traditional British menu by an open fire with oak panelling.

Elegant Rooms and Modern Comforts
Retreat to elegantly appointed rooms featuring en suite bathrooms, tea/coffee facilities, and luxurious toiletries. Enjoy modern amenities such as a TV, Wi-Fi, and room service while surrounded by historic elements like exposed beams and sloping ceilings.

Pros:

Location good for main tourist attractions, buses, station, shops and river.
Interesting to stay in such an historic building.
Room was spacious with attractive old beams dividing sleeping area from seating area.
Breakfast had good range of food, gluten free bread available on request

Cons:

Visited during heatwave, no air conditioning or fans in public areas, hotel only had a limited number of fans for bedrooms, none available for us. Definite disadvantage as our room faced the sun so was stifling despite windows open and curtains drawn.
In the bathroom the toilet was right next to the end of the bath, making it quite difficult to get in and out of the bath/shower, needed to fold shower screen right back. It would have been helpful, especially for older people, to have a handrail on wall above the bath and near the shower. The 2 pin plug socket for razors/toothbrush chargers was placed so high up on the wall that it wasn’t possible for us to reach it.
